I am going to use E-Portfolio to share reports and would like to customise the appearance of the web pages. Nothing too radical but I need to -
Change to colours of the bars at the top
Replace the E-Portfolio logo with a different logo
Remove the 'Exit' hyperlink at the top

Can anyone point me in the direction of some simple guidelines for doing this please.

Thanks very much.
 
If you look at the URL at each point that you want to customise that is a good starting point eg available.csp

There is a good book called "Using Crystal Enterprise 8.5" published by QUE which I use quite a bit.

On colour usage generally there is a cascading style sheet under Enterprise\Eportfolio\en\css on your server that is used for a lot of the font standards.

There is quite a bit of sample code in the book providing suggestions on how to build your own EPortfolio equivalent or admin frontends.
 
Radical changes to the display are probably more related to javascript and asp programming than to Crystal specifically. The SDK guide does a poor job of explaining the interface to the data stores. I've had the QUE book on my desk since long before I thought of doing my own customizations, but ironically I did not even look at it during my customization effort. I got more help out of javascript, asp, and html programming references along with the SDK guide and samples as mentioned. All that plus a healthy dose of trial-and-error.

Plus there are a lot of anomalies with the SQL-like queries against the APS object model. Like selecting WHERE SI_INSTANCE (=, IS) (FALSE, 'FALSE'). I finally guessed that SI_INSTANCE is either 0 or 1, but displayed as TRUE or FALSE in the Query Builder - another helpful resource.

One problem with the samples is that you have to bilingual, in both javascript and jscript, and want to translate into or out of a VB format.
